Official Advertising Policies on Google Ads
Google Ads implements specific policies for advertising by government entities. These rules aim to ensure transparency, accountability, and responsible use of the platform. Agencies representing governmental departments must adhere to these policies to guarantee compliance and prevent account suspension. Key areas covered include disclosure of government affiliation, message restrictions on sensitive topics, and exclusion on certain advertising practices.
- Government advertisers must clearly reveal their governmental affiliation in all ads.
- Incentives cannot be made using public funds or resources.
- Electoral advertising is subject to strict regulations and may require additional approvals.

Public Document Confirmation in Google Ads
To ensure the legitimacy and reliability of your advertising campaigns on Google Ads, it's crucial to verify government documents. This process involves submitting copies of authorized identification and documentation to authenticate your organization's standing. Google Ads may demand this verification for numerous reasons, including preventing fraud and ensuring a safe and open advertising environment.
- Commonly, Google Ads may need document verification for new accounts or when there are concerns of illegitimate activity.
- Additionally, certain fields might have stricter rules regarding document verification in Google Ads advertising.
- Observing to these policies is necessary to maintain a compliant advertising presence on the platform.
